Job Overview
As a Senior Business Analyst specializing in Manufacturing, you will help Komatsu to support existing plants as well as to build and deploy new solutions such as MES/MOM and OT Security. As such, you will use your industry insights and experience to understand and enrich our product vision. Main tasks will include performing detailed requirements analysis, documenting processes and process changes, relaying requirements to downstream technical teams for build and deploy functions, and coordinating user acceptance testing. To succeed in this role you should have strong communications skills, an analytical way of thinking and be able to quickly learn, absorb, and explain complex business concepts as well as IT enablement concepts.
This role will be expected be conversant in the following areas:
• Manufacturing Execution Systems (MES)
• Manufacturing Operations Management (MOM)
• Remanufacturing (REMAN) processes
• Operation Technology (OT) Security
• SCADA systems
• PLCs, and other shop-floor systems.
• General manufacturing processes
Key Job Responsibilities
• Partner with business stakeholders to identify and capture business requirements, documenting those in Azure DevOps (ADO).
• Analyze and document current processes, changes to processes, and/or new processes to be defined, including cross-functional impacts across business functions.
• Cascade requirements to downstream technical teams, including providing explanations as needed to build teams and/or project teams.
• Make configuration changes to manufacturing applications or PLCs, including system updates as needed, and provide business support.
• Author and update internal and external documentation, and formally initiate and deliver requirements and documentation
• Lead meetings, e.g., business requirements review, testing engagement, etc.
• Actively participate in formal presentations to a variety of management levels.
• Coordinate system/user testing as required; analyze and validate testing results.
• Act as a reference and provide support to application users with respect to questions arising from application/functionality adoption and use.
• Perform rules authoring as required to support business requirements
• Stay current with industry trends and best practices in manufacturing.
Qualifications/Requirements
• Bachelor’s degree in information technology or a related field
• Minimum of five years of prior Business Analyst experience or equivalent experience supporting Manufacturing systems.
• Strong understanding of process engineering and re-engineering, as well as process optimization.
• Experience with manufacturing systems, from PLCs to SCADA, and MES/MOM systems.
• Familiarity with DevOps platforms, including documentation of epics/user stories/features, as well as requirements traceability (RTM).

Company Information
Komatsu develops and supplies technologies, equipment and services for the construction, mining, forklift, industrial and forestry markets. Headquartered in Tokyo, Japan, Komatsu employs more than 64,000 people worldwide, operating in more than 140 countries. For more than a century, the company has been creating value for its customers through manufacturing and technology innovation, partnering with others to empower a sustainable future where people, business and the planet thrive together. Since the company’s founding in 1921, Komatsu has been committed to supporting individuals and communities through job training, skills development and giving back.
